Stuck Handles
If a uPVC window has become stuck it could be because of a problem with the handle or mechanism. These mechanisms can be fixed in a short amount of time to ensure that the windows continue working properly. To avoid any problems, it is important to clean and maintain uPVC Windows.
uPVC window handles most commonly used are espagnolette handles. They are equipped with a multipoint locking system that adds to the security of the window, with locking cams that resemble mushrooms that lock into the window frame keeps. The handle is usually capable of opening and closing the window with no problems. If the handle gets stuck, it could be due to an issue with the spindle within the handle.
It is a good thing that replacing a handle made of uPVC is a relatively simple process that anyone can complete using a few tools and basic know-how. The most important thing to do for a successful replacement is identifying your handle type, measuring the spindle length and then purchasing a replacement handle that is the same size as your existing one. When you have the appropriate tools and the new part it shouldn't take more than 30 mins.
